Personalized Photo Gifts

There's nothing quite like the sentimental value of a personalized photo gift. From custom photo albums to photo blankets and pillows, these gifts provide a tangible reminder of cherished memories with loved ones.The great thing about personalized photo gifts is that they can be tailored to suit any budget. Online photo printing services often offer a wide range of customized gift options at affordable prices.

Comfortable Clothing

As we age, comfort is key when it comes to clothing. Consider gifting a soft and cozy robe, slippers or pajamas for your elderly loved ones. For seniors with mobility issues, adaptive clothing can also make a huge difference in their daily comfort and ease of movement. Look for options with easy to fasten closures and non-slip soles for added safety.

Subscription Services

Subscription services make for great gifts as they provide ongoing enjoyment over an extended period of time. Depending on the recipient's interests, you could consider gifting a subscription to a magazine, book club, or even a streaming service like Netflix or Amazon Prime.

Memory Journals

Memory journals provide a space for your elderly loved one to reflect on their past, share their stories and memories, and record special moments. These guided journals typically contain prompts and questions to help them capture their thoughts and experiences.Memory journals can also serve as a bonding opportunity between generations, allowing younger family members to learn more about their loved one's life experiences.

Personal Care Items

Personal care items like toiletries and grooming supplies can make a practical yet thoughtful gift. Consider gifting products that provide relief for specific ailments such as arthritis or sensitive skin.For example, a heated massager or a set of gentle skincare products would be great options. Just ensure that the products are tailored to the individual's needs and preferences.

Electronic Devices

Electronic devices like tablets, e-readers, or digital photo frames can make great gifts for seniors who enjoy technology. These devices provide new opportunities for entertainment and socializing with loved ones.It's important to keep in mind the recipient's level of technological savvy and choose devices that are user-friendly and easy to navigate.

Food and Beverage Gifts

Food and beverage gifts can provide a welcomed treat for our aging loved ones. From gourmet chocolate gift boxes to tea samplers and artisanal snacks, there are plenty of options to choose from.If your loved one has specific dietary needs or restrictions, be sure to choose options that cater to their needs.

Hobby-Related Gifts

Gifts that cater to hobbies can help our elderly loved ones stay engaged and active. Consider gifting items related to art, gardening, or music for seniors who enjoy those activities.For example, a beginner's painting kit, a set of gardening tools, or a musical instrument could be great options.

Games and Puzzles

Playing games and solving puzzles can provide a fun way for our elderly loved ones to keep their minds sharp. Consider gifting games like chess or checkers sets, playing cards, or puzzle books.These gifts can also provide an opportunity for socializing with family and friends.

Home Safety Items

Home safety items may not seem like glamorous gifts, but they can provide peace of mind and increased safety for our elderly loved ones. Consider gifting items like night lights, non-slip bath mats, or grab bars for their bathrooms.These items can help reduce the risk of accidents and promote independence and confidence in everyday tasks.

  9. What are some practical gifts for elderly with mobility issues?
  10. Answer: Some practical gifts for elderly with mobility issues include a lift chair, a wheelchair ramp, a shower chair, and a bed rail.

  19. What are some gift ideas for elderly with dementia?
  20. Answer: Some gift ideas for elderly with dementia include a fidget quilt, a music player with familiar songs, and a memory box filled with items from their past.
